Purpose and Functionality

The Helix 7 Cover is designed specifically to protect the Helix 7 fish finder from environmental hazards, such as sun exposure and adverse weather conditions. Made from 4mm thick neoprene, it provides excellent protection from scratches, drops, and impacts, which is crucial for maintaining the longevity of your device. On the other hand, the HOLACA Transducer Mount serves as a mounting solution for various pole types, including those with diameters ranging from 0.78 inches to 1.96 inches. This versatility is ideal for anglers who use different types of fishing poles and need a secure and reliable way to attach their transducer.

Installation and Ease of Use

In terms of installation, the Helix 7 Cover is designed for straightforward application. Users can easily stretch the cover over the fish finder, ensuring a snug fit that withstands strong winds. This user-friendly design is critical for those who frequently transport their equipment. Meanwhile, the HOLACA Transducer Mount boasts a clamp-style design with a dual bolt tightening system. This allows for a secure attachment of the transducer while also offering a quick release feature for easy disassembly and storage. Each product excels in ease of use, tailored to its specific function.
